Overview

Antioxidant high-toughness film is a polymer-based material engineered for applications requiring both mechanical durability and resistance to oxidative degradation. It combines advanced polymer formulations with antioxidant additives to extend service life in demanding environments. These films are typically produced through extrusion or lamination processes, allowing customization of thickness and surface properties. The material's versatility makes it suitable for industries ranging from food packaging to industrial protective layers.

Physical and Chemical Properties

The film exhibits exceptional tensile strength (typically 50-100 MPa) and elongation at break (200-500%), making it resistant to tearing and punctures. Its antioxidant properties derive from incorporated stabilizers that scavenge free radicals and prevent chain scission. Key characteristics include low moisture permeability (0.5-2 g/m²/day) and excellent thermal stability, maintaining performance across -40°C to 120°C. The surface can be treated for specific properties like antistatic behavior or printability.

Main Applications

In food packaging, these films protect sensitive products from oxygen exposure while withstanding mechanical stresses during transportation. They meet FDA and EU food contact material regulations when properly formulated. The electronics industry utilizes them as protective layers for flexible circuits and display components, where oxidation resistance prevents conductive pathway degradation. Industrial applications include protective coatings for metal parts in corrosive environments.

Safety and Storage

While generally safe for handling, proper ventilation is recommended when processing at high temperatures. The film should be stored in original packaging to prevent UV degradation and moisture absorption. Disposal should follow local regulations for plastic films. Some formulations are recyclable, though compatibility with recycling streams depends on the specific polymer composition and any coatings applied.

B2B Procurement Guide

When sourcing antioxidant high-toughness film, specify required thickness (commonly 25-200 microns), width, and roll length. Technical datasheets should include oxygen transmission rate (OTR) and mechanical property guarantees. For custom applications, discuss additive packages with suppliers - options may include UV stabilizers for outdoor use or antifog agents for food packaging. Minimum order quantities typically range from 500-2,000 square meters for standard formulations.
